Informational Asymmetry

A situation where one party in a transaction has more or superior information compared to another. This often leads to an imbalance in power or decision-making.

Hidden Action

A situation in principal-agent relationships where the agent's actions are not fully observable by the principal, potentially leading to agency problems.

Hidden Characteristic

A quality of a product or service that is not immediately observable to the buyer, often leading to information asymmetry in the market.

Transitive

In logic and mathematics, transitive refers to a relation where if it applies between successive pairs in a sequence, it also applies between any two members taken in order. For example, if A is larger than B, and B is larger than C, then A is larger than C.
